Cinnamon fan biscuits

Ingredients

  • 2 cups flour
  • 4 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p cream of tartar
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 cup shortening
  • 3/4 cup milk
  • 2 Tbsp sugar
  • 1 tsp cinnamon

Details

Servings 12

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at oven to 450. Grease 12 muffin cups and set aside.
In a large bowl stir together flour, baking powder, cream of tartar and salt. Using a pastry blender, cut in shortening until m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Make a wll in the center of the flour mixture. Add milk all at once. Using a fork, stir just until mixture is moistened.
Turn dough out onto a lightly floured surface. Knead dough by folding and gently pressing for 10-12 strokes or until dough is nearly smooth, Divide dough in half. Roll each half into a 12x10 rectangle. In a small bowl stir together sugar and cinnamon. Sprinkle the sugar mixture over the rectangles.
Cut each rectangle into 5 12x12 strips. Stack the strips on top of each other; cut each into six 2" square stacks. Place each stack, cut side down, in a prepared muffin cup. Bake for 10-12 minutes; serve warm.
